Petrobras Encourages And Supports More Women In Leadership And Also Racial Diversity In Its Strategic Plan 2021-2025 And Human Rights Guidelines
Wishing to encourage more women in leadership positions, Petrobras announced in a relevant fact yesterday (12/21) that it launched the Gender Equity Plan with a series of actions to promote Diversity, in line with the Human Rights Guidelines and the company’s Strategic Plan 2021-2025.

Highlighting the Female Leadership Mentoring Program in the plan presented by Petrobras, which intends to support the development of female leadership and, consequently, enhance the positive results brought by a more diverse and inclusive internal environment.
According to Petrobras’ report, the plan also includes initiatives such as a program to encourage the increase of female representation in supervisory positions in operational areas; monitoring of data and Diversity & Inclusion Research; creation of affinity groups; in addition to various training and awareness fronts, to be consolidated or implemented in 2021.

“The actions were defined based on the evaluation of the company’s context and therefore with special attention to the operational areas where female representation is lower. Currently, women represent 17% of the company’s workforce. Of the total leaders, across all hierarchical positions, women account for 15%”, said the state-owned company.
It is worth noting that one of the recent advances occurred in the composition of Petrobras’ senior leadership. In the last two years, the number of executive managers (the first level below the board) increased from 5 to 12, representing 30% of the total positions in this function. Among the directors, women hold two of the eight seats, or 25% of the total. There is also one woman on Petrobras’ Board of Directors. At Transpetro, the Board of Directors includes the participation of a Black woman.
Petrobras Female Leadership Mentoring Program
Petrobras employees selected for the Female Leadership Mentoring Program (a pilot project with 15 spots, including 11 for women and leaders of operational areas) will participate in meetings with mentors, as well as workshops, webinars, and meetings, with directors Andrea Almeida, of Finance and Investor Relations, and Anelise Lara, of Refining and Natural Gas, as mentors.
Part of Petrobras’ plans includes increasing internal diversity regarding racial representation. “Currently, the company is making an effort to encourage employees to update their self-declaration of color and race in the company’s records. Based on more accurate information about the internal context, actions will be developed to promote racial diversity. In addition to the record update, a Diversity & Inclusion Survey will be conducted in 2021, the results of which will guide the company’s efforts on various fronts”, said Petrobras in the statement.
